SWIMMING.
.(By "Splash.")
In reading the Hutt News "Splash" was pleased to see an article on the heating of the baths. This was a good piece of work and it is needed very badly in this town. It is surprising that such an asset as the baths should just stand there to pay their way as best they can. It is to be hoped that something can be done duTingthe coming winter. ,
The following, were the results of the Centre Championship meeting -held en the 13th February.. It will be seen that the Hutt Club did well in the Junior and Intermediate Championships. This goes to prove /that we &aye the goods which would be brought up to a higher standard if the baths were heated.
100 Yards Beasley Cup Handicap (Men)>— Cleland 1, Milne 2, Cartwright 3. Time 76 3-ssee. This was an evenly contested race, Cleland winning by a touch. Cartwright, with 9 points, wins the cup. Milne and Carfcwright dead heat for second with 8 points. *
100 Yards Ladies' Beasley Gup^ Handicap—Miss I. Price, 1, Miss P. Price 2, Miss M, House 3v Time 86 4-5, Miss I. Price won by four yards. She wins the cup wifeh 10 points. Miss P. Price is second with 9 points and Miss House third with 7 points.
1001 Yards Breatstioke Handicap.— L. Deans 1, H} Tremewan 2, J. Morrison 3. Time 87sec.
Dive—X. Tuppin 1, M. Jameson *?. School Boys 66 2-5 Yards Handicap.— Miller 1, Piper 2, Astill 3. /.. .
School Girls, 33 1-5 Yards Handicap. —N. Treahy 1, A. Aldfi'dge and D. Milne (dead heat) 2. '
